Financial Action Task Force

22. March 2011

Technically, the FATF does not issue sanctions. It requires its members (who themselves decide on the appropriate course of action) to implement "counter-measures." But they have no effect until the member countries instruct their financial institutions to comply because the FATF is not a law-making body. However, prudence would suggest that financial institutions take account of FATF pronouncements so as to be ready for implementation when national governments make appropriate enforcement provisions.

Sanctions : UN Security Council 20110226 - Libya

27. February 2011

26 February 2011: The United Nations Security Council has unanimously voted for a range of sanctions against President Muammar Al-Qadhafi and several senior figures and related entities. The full UN statement is below UPDATE: Full list in force as from 27 February 2011.
